Better, for most people. In person you get me for an hour, then you're on your own for the other 167 hours a week. That's where results are won or lost. Most of my best transformations have never trained next to me once.
Most people who've tried coaching had someone who turned up for the hour they were paid for and that was it. Nothing between sessions. The work happens between sessions, and that's where results come from.
Strength usually moves in the first two or three weeks. Visible changes tend to show around week six to eight if you're executing. The people who move fastest are the ones who've been doing the wrong thing consistently for years.
A training programme built around your job, your injuries and the gym you actually use. Nutrition that fits your week. Weekly check ins where I go through your training videos, your food and your sleep. Direct message access to me. We work in blocks of 8 to 12 weeks.
Mostly people who work a desk job, have stopped moving, and want to lose fat and build a bit of muscle without living in the gym. Men and women. Complete beginners through to people who already train and have stalled.
